linux 默认路由
时间: 2023-11-01 13:59:34 浏览: 53
Linux默认路由是指在Linux系统中用于指定发送数据包的默认路径的配置。默认路由通常被称为网关,它是一个特殊的IP地址,用于指示当目标IP地址不属于本地网络时数据包的下一跳位置。
在Linux系统中,可以使用route命令来添加默认路由。具体的命令格式可以是:
```
# route add default gw <网关IP地址>
```
或者:
```
# route add -net 0.0.0.0 gw <网关IP地址>
```
需要注意的是,在添加默认路由时,必须加上`-net`参数。另外,需要将`<网关IP地址>`替换为实际的网关IP地址。
另外,需要明确一点的是,每个Linux系统中只能存在一个默认路由。当配置多块网卡时,每个网卡都要配置IP地址,而默认路由只能存在于其中一块网卡中。通常情况下,最大的网卡ID对应的网卡会被设置为默认路由的网卡。可以使用`ip r`命令来查看默认路由的网卡。
相关问题
Linux 默认路由
在Linux中,默认路由是指当主机无法在路由表中找到目标主机的IP地址或网络路由时,数据包会被发送到默认路由(默认网关)上。默认路由的配置可以通过添加默认路由命令来实现。在Linux中,可以使用以下命令来添加默认路由:
```
# route add default gw <gateway_ip>
```
其中,`<gateway_ip>`是默认网关的IP地址。另外,也可以使用以下命令来添加默认路由:
```
# route add -net 0.0.0.0 gw <gateway_ip>
```
需要注意的是,添加默认路由的前提是要加上`-net`参数。默认路由的配置也可以在`/etc/sysctl.conf`文件中进行永久设置,具体的配置项是`net.ipv4.ip_forward`,将其设置为1即可开启默认路由功能。
Linux添加默认路由
在Linux系统中,可以通过以下步骤来添加默认路由:
1. 打开终端,使用root权限登录系统。
2. 使用命令ip route show或route -n命令查看当前系统的路由表。
3. 使用命令ip route add default或route add default命令添加默认路由。例如,添加默认路由命令为:
ip route add default via <网关IP>
或
route add default gw <网关IP>
其中,<网关IP>是要连接到目标网络的网关的IP地址。
4. 使用命令ip route del或route del命令删除默认路由。例如,删除默认路由命令为:
ip route del default
或
route del default
5. 使用命令ip route flush或route flush命令清空路由表。
6. 使用命令ip route save或route save命令将路由表保存到配置文件中。
注意:在配置路由时,需要确保网络连接正常,网关IP地址正确。如果需要设置多个默认路由,可以使用不同的metric值来区分优先级。默认路由的metric值是0,其他路由的metric值是1或更大。默认情况下,系统会选择metric值最小的路由作为默认路由。